Understanding ICU Setup at HomeAn ICU setup at home provides the infrastructure and equipment typically available in hospital intensive care units. This includes advanced monitoring systems, ventilators, oxygen support, infusion pumps, and beds designed for critically ill patients. The goal is to create a controlled medical environment where patients can receive continuous care under the supervision of trained healthcare professionals. By replicating hospital-level care at home, patients benefit from both medical expertise and the comfort of being in a familiar environment, which can aid in recovery and reduce stress. Key Components of a Home ICU SetupA comprehensive ICU setup at home requires several essential components to ensure effective treatment and patient safety. These include: 1. ICU Bed and Patient Support EquipmentSpecialized beds with adjustable features help in proper positioning, reduce bedsores, and allow for easier access during medical procedures. 2. Oxygen Supply SystemsOxygen cylinders or concentrators provide life-saving support to patients with breathing difficulties. 3. Monitoring DevicesVital signs monitors track heart rate, blood pressure, oxygen saturation, and other critical parameters in real-time. 4. Ventilators and BiPAP MachinesFor patients with respiratory distress, ventilators and non-invasive ventilation devices assist in breathing and stabilize oxygen levels. 5. Trained Healthcare StaffQualified nurses and technicians are crucial to manage equipment, administer medications, and provide round-the-clock care.
